Notes on a Collection of Fishes from the Southern Tributaries of the Cumberland River in Kentucky and Tennessee
Kirsch PH. 1893. Notes on a Collection of Fishes from the Southern Tributaries of the Cumberland River in Kentucky and Tennessee. Bulletin of the United States Fish Commission. 11:258-268
A fish species list from tributaries of the Cumberland River, Tennessee and Kentucky, collected in the summer of 1891. There is a description for each of the rivers sampled including river characteristics, location, and date sampled. A fish species list accomanies each of the river descriptions and includes scientific name, relative abundance, and notes on the specimens (size, description, etc.)
